Impact of Ventricular Stroke Work on Outcomes After Tricuspid Transcatheter Edge-to-Edge Repair.

BACKGROUND Tricuspid transcatheter edge-to-edge repair (T-TEER) is an effective treatment for severe tricuspid regurgitation (TR), but predictors of outcome and clinical benefit after T-TEER remain limited. METHODS In 144 patients with severe symptomatic TR undergoing T-TEER, left and right ventricular stroke work indices (LVSWI, RVSWI) were calculated from invasive hemodynamics by right heart catheterization. Patients were stratified by median values (LVSWI 27 cJ/m2, RVSWI 6 cJ/m2) into four subgroups. The primary endpoint was one-year all-cause mortality. RESULTS After T-TEER, all-cause mortality was 28%. Outcomes differed significantly across subgroups: LVSWI high, RVSWI high: 15%, LVSWI high, RVSWI low: 15%, LVSWI low, RVSWI high: 55%, and LVSWI low, RVSWI low: 31% (Kaplan-Meier, log-rank p = 0.00027). Patients with low LVSWI but high RVSWI had the poorest survival, characterized by elevated pulmonary artery pressures, pulmonary capillary wedge pressure, and left ventricular transmural pressure. In univariate Cox regression, LVSWI below the median predicted mortality (≤ 27 cJ/m2; HR 4.73, 95% CI 2.07-10.8; p < 0.001), whereas RVSWI did not. LVSWI remained an independent predictor after adjusting in multivariate analysis (HR 0.44, 95% CI 0.27-0.71; p < 0.001). CONCLUSION LVSWI is a robust, independent prognostic marker after T-TEER, whereas RVSWI alone lacks predictive value. A discordant profile of low LVSWI with high RVSWI identifies a particularly high-risk subgroup with >50% mortality within one year. Incorporating stroke work indices into pre-procedural assessment may refine risk stratification and optimize management strategies in T-TEER candidates.

One-Year Outcomes of M-TEER With the PASCAL System in Atrial and Ventricular FMR: Insights From the MiCLASP Postmarket Clinical Follow-Up Study.

BACKGROUND Studies on mitral transcatheter edge-to-edge repair for atrial functional mitral regurgitation (AFMR) and ventricular functional mitral regurgitation (VFMR) are limited. METHODS We report 1-year outcomes of mitral transcatheter edge-to-edge repair for AFMR and VFMR using the PASCAL transcatheter valve repair system in the MiCLASP multicenter European postmarket clinical follow-up study (REGISTRATION: URL: https://www.clinicaltrials.gov; Unique identifier: NCT04430075). RESULTS Analysis included 295 patients with functional mitral regurgitation (75.5±9.93 years old, 59.3% male) from the first 600 enrolled in the MiCLASP study, with AFMR in 17.6% (52) and VFMR in 82.4% (243). Patients with AFMR were older (79.7±6.67 versus 74.6±10.30 years), majority female (75.0% versus 33.3%), and had higher rates of hypertension (98.1% versus 82.3%) and atrial fibrillation (82.7% versus 60.1%) than patients with VFMR (all P<0.05). Patients with VFMR had higher NT-proBNP (N-terminal pro-B-type natriuretic peptide) levels (3350.0 [1720.0-6564.0] versus 1562.0 [790.0-2286.0]; P<0.001) and more severe mitral regurgitation (≥3+) at baseline (71.9% versus 46.2%; P<0.001). Procedural success was high (AFMR, 96.2%; VFMR, 97.1%; P=0.661), and patients with AFMR had shorter procedure duration (73.5 versus 85.5 minutes; P=0.044). One-year Kaplan-Meier estimate of freedom from all-cause mortality or heart failure hospitalizations was 79.3% in AFMR and 70.9% in VFMR (P=0.267). Both AFMR and VFMR groups demonstrated significant mitral regurgitation reduction (mitral regurgitation ≤1+, 93.1% and 81.3%), low mean transmitral gradients (3.5 and 3.1 mm Hg), significant proportional reductions in left ventricular end-diastolic volume (-12.9% and -16.4%) and left atrial volume (-9.6% and -10.9%), high proportions at New York Heart Association class I/II (76.5% and 64.6%), and significant increases in Kansas City Cardiomyopathy Questionnaire Overall Summary score (+18.0 and +11.6 points), respectively (all P<0.05 from baseline). CONCLUSIONS One-year MiCLASP results support the safety of mitral transcatheter edge-to-edge repair with the PASCAL system in both AFMR and VFMR, with comparable echocardiographic, functional, and quality-of-life changes, despite baseline differences in clinical presentation.
